SIP trunking is another advanced telecommunications solution offered by Tpad. Compared to VoIP, SIP trunking is more advanced. While VoIP offers only voice calls, SIP trunking uses the same Internet-based transmission to enable video calls, instant messaging, conference calls, and video conferencing.



This means it exploits all possible communication methods using a single system. Despite the greater amout of data handled by SIP gateways, they are still able to handle greater traffic at high speeds. 6 reasons why should you use Tpad’s PBX Pro Telephony Solution:

1. Lower CAPEX Costs: Buying a traditional phone system is like buying an expensive new car, it significantly depreciates the day you place it in service. You can put that money to better use by spending less up-front by installing a VoIP managed PBX system.

2. A VoIP Managed PBX is Dynamically Scalable: Up-size and Down-size on the fly. VoIP managed PBX Service lets you buy the exact number of users you need right now - later you can add users when you actually need them. This helps preserve capital in comparison to guessing what size PBX system you need to buy today to support the number of users you think you'll have in 3 - 5 years.

3. A VoIP managed PBX is Cheaper, Easier to maintain and Update: Moves, Add's and Changes no longer require on-site changes to your phone system. Your VoIP managed PBXs can be easily changed via the Call Management Software, thus the flexibility to add, change, delete or move users within minutes. Your expenses will be reduced by eliminating costly monthly maintenance contracts or the high labour cost required to have a tech onsite for every change you need.

4. A VoIP managed PBX Uses Non-Proprietary Components: When you buy a traditional PBX phone system, you're locking your company into a long term commitment to a proprietary architecture that may or may not keep pace with technological changes. Bottom line, you are betting your company's future that the proprietary technology will remain compatible with evolving industry standards. In the future, there's a good chance with a traditional PBX you'll be at the manufacturer's mercy for repair and expansion since only their parts will work with your purchase. Make sure your VoIP managed PBX system works with multiple phone manufacturers. So if you decide to move to a different system, a forklift upgrade won't be necessary.

5. A VoIP System Eliminates Technology Obsolescence: Since you're not purchasing a phone system, you don't have to worry about the equipment becoming obsolete.

6. Improved Features for Improved Productivity: Most enterprise VoIP managed Voice service providers include advanced calling features that are not available with traditional phone systems. Features that will improve the way you control your calling, like Visual Voicemail, Unique DID's, Find-Me/Follow-Me, Click-to-Call.
